What are the most common Subaru repair issues for drivers in the Mars Hill area?

Due to our cold, snowy winters and hilly terrain, common issues include premature wear on suspension components like control arms and struts, as well as all-wheel-drive system concerns. Head gasket leaks on older Subaru models (typically pre-2012) are also a frequent repair, exacerbated by temperature extremes.

When should I seek service for my Subaru's all-wheel-drive system given our local driving conditions?

You should seek immediate service if you notice unusual binding or jerking when turning, especially on dry pavement, or if the AWD warning light illuminates. Proactive checks before winter are wise, as a malfunctioning system severely reduces traction on our icy Route 1 and back roads.

Are Subaru repair costs higher in Mars Hill comp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in Aroostook County can be slightly lower than in metropolitan areas, but parts availability may cause delays, potentially increasing downtime. It's best to get written estimates that account for potential shipping of specialized components to our remote location.
